DiabloCopy Posted June 5, 2005 Share Posted June 5, 2005 New Java plug-in will allow you to probably play runescape without any trouble in Mozilla browsers. (If you are on a MAC using OS X) 1. Get the plug-in from http://www.macworld.com/0381 2. Quit your browser 3. Open up the binaries folder (from the download), and drag the two files into Mac's top level Library/Internet Plug-Ins folder. 4. The plug-in MUST load before the other two MAC Java plug-ins! View the folder in list form, and hit date modified once. The MJRPlugin.plugin must load before the two Apple-provided files, JavaApplet.plugin and Java Applet Plugin Enabler.
